Research On Upgrading Renovation Of DCS System Of #3 Generator Unit In Dalate Power Plant

The control system of generating units in power plants is important.This paper is to upgrade the control system of #3unit of the 330 MW sub critical coal-fired generating unit of the Dalate power plant.In order to avoid the unsafe and stable factors caused by the long operation time of the control system,This paper studies the upgrading of the power plant to ensure the normal operation of the system.First of all,the paper analyzes the basic theory of DCS control system,and introduces its functionality and expansibility from four aspects of field level,process control level,operation monitoring level and information management level.Aiming at the problem of DCS control system strategy,the digital PID algorithm is studied,and the algorithm optimization is analyzed.The data communication medium,data communication topology and data communication standard are introduced,the typical DCS(I/A Series 50)control system is selected for research and discussion.Secondly,the general situation of the Dalate-Power-Plant is introduced,and the composition,structure,software and hardware of the DCS system of unit #3(the I/A Series series produced by FOXBORO company)are expounded.This paper analyses the problems existing in the DCS control system,such as the serious aging of the equipment,the shutdown of some components,the control of the system controller,the IO card,the DEH,the TSI,the high and low bypass control failures.Based on the problems existing in the DCS control system,3 DCS system transformation schemes are given,and the advantages and disadvantages of each scheme are analyzed from the perspectives of economy,security and automation.Finally,the budget analysis of the 3 proposed reform schemes is carried out.The analysis and comparison of the reform contents of the auxiliary control system and the transformation of the main control DCS system are carried out in the analysis.Based on the analysis and calculation results,the optimal transformation scheme of DCS control system is selected,and the economic and social benefits after transformation are analyzed.
